- RVH 111 - Introduction to Motorcycle Mechanics I-II
- Covers theory of operation, differences of operation, preventive maintenance, and operating principles involved in servicing and repairing motorcycles, ATV's and personal watercraft. Upon completion, students should be able to perform basic inspection, diagnosis, repair and/or adjustment of motorcycles, ATV's and personal watercraft. Part II of II.Lecture 2 hours. Laboratory 4 hours. Total 6 hours per week.
4 credits - RVH 130 - Motorcycle Rider Safety - Beginner
- Studies principles and basic skills of motorcycle riding with an emphasis on safety. Includes street strategies, protective gear, and selection and care/maintenance of motorcycles.Lecture 1-2 hours. Laboratory 1-2 hours. Total 2-3 hours per week.
